1# $Id: bsd.after-import.mk,v 1.5 2012/06/20 22:45:07 sjg Exp $ 2 3# This makefile is for use when integrating bmake into a BSD build 4# system. Use this makefile after importing bmake. 5# It will bootstrap the new version, 6# capture the generated files we need, and add an after-import 7# target to allow the process to be easily repeated. 8 9# The goal is to allow the benefits of autoconf without 10# the overhead of running configure. 11 12all: ${.CURDIR}/Makefile 13all: after-import 14 15# we rely on bmake 16.if !defined(.MAKE.LEVEL) 17.error this makefile requires bmake 18.endif 19 20_this := ${MAKEFILE:tA} 21BMAKE_SRC := ${.PARSEDIR} 22 23# it helps to know where the top of the tree is. 24.if !defined(SRCTOP) 25srctop := ${.MAKE.MAKEFILES:M*src/share/mk/sys.mk:H:H:H} 26.if empty(srctop) 27# likely locations? 28.for d in contrib/bmake external/bsd/bmake/dist 29.if ${BMAKE_SRC:M*/$d} != "" 30srctop := ${BMAKE_SRC:tA:S,/$d,,} 31.endif 32.endfor 33.endif 34.if !empty(srctop) 35SRCTOP := ${srctop} 36.endif 37.endif 38 39# This lets us match what boot-strap does 40.if !defined(HOST_OS) 41HOST_OS!= uname 42.endif 43 44# .../share/mk will find ${SRCTOP}/share/mk 45# if we are within ${SRCTOP} 46DEFAULT_SYS_PATH= .../share/mk:/usr/share/mk 47 48BOOTSTRAP_ARGS = \ 49 --with-default-sys-path='${DEFAULT_SYS_PATH}' \ 50 --prefix /usr \ 51 --share /usr/share \ 52 --mksrc none 53 54# run boot-strap with minimal influence 55bootstrap: ${BMAKE_SRC}/boot-strap ${MAKEFILE} 56 HOME=/ ${BMAKE_SRC}/boot-strap ${BOOTSTRAP_ARGS} ${BOOTSTRAP_XTRAS} 57 touch ${.TARGET} 58 59# Makefiles need a little more tweaking than say config.h 60MAKEFILE_SED = sed -e '/^MACHINE/d' \ 61 -e '/^PROG/s,bmake,${.CURDIR:T},' \ 62 -e 's,^.-include,.sinclude,' \ 63 -e 's,${SRCTOP},$${SRCTOP},g' 64 65# These are the simple files we want to capture 66configured_files= config.h unit-tests/Makefile 67 68after-import: bootstrap ${MAKEFILE} 69.for f in ${configured_files:N*Makefile} 70 @echo Capturing $f 71 @mkdir -p ${${.CURDIR}/$f:L:H} 72 @cmp -s ${.CURDIR}/$f ${HOST_OS}/$f || \ 73 cp ${HOST_OS}/$f ${.CURDIR}/$f 74.endfor 75.for f in ${configured_files:M*Makefile} 76 @echo Capturing $f 77 @mkdir -p ${${.CURDIR}/$f:L:H} 78 @${MAKEFILE_SED} ${HOST_OS}/$f > ${.CURDIR}/$f 79.endfor 80 81# this needs the most work 82${.CURDIR}/Makefile: bootstrap ${MAKEFILE} .PRECIOUS 83 @echo Generating ${.TARGET:T} 84 @(echo '# This is a generated file, do NOT edit!'; \ 85 echo '# See ${_this:S,${SRCTOP}/,,}'; \ 86 echo '#'; echo '# $$${OS}$$'; echo; \ 87 echo 'SRCTOP?= $${.CURDIR:${.CURDIR:S,${SRCTOP}/,,:C,[^/]+,H,g:S,/,:,g}}'; echo; \ 88 echo; echo '# look here first for config.h'; \ 89 echo 'CFLAGS+= -I$${.CURDIR}'; echo; \ 90 ${MAKEFILE_SED} ${HOST_OS}/Makefile; \ 91 echo; echo '# override some simple things'; \ 92 echo 'BINDIR= /usr/bin'; \ 93 echo 'MANDIR= /usr/share/man'; \ 94 echo; echo '# make sure we get this'; \ 95 echo 'CFLAGS+= $${COPTS.$${.IMPSRC:T}}'; \ 96 echo 'CLEANFILES+= bootstrap'; \ 97 echo; echo 'after-import: ${_this:S,${SRCTOP},\${SRCTOP},}'; \ 98 echo ' cd $${.CURDIR} && $${.MAKE} -f ${_this:S,${SRCTOP},\${SRCTOP},}'; \ 99 echo; echo '.sinclude "Makefile.inc"'; \ 100 echo ) > ${.TARGET:T}.new 101 @mv ${.TARGET:T}.new ${.TARGET} 102 103.include <bsd.obj.mk> 104 105
